# Heads up, security reviewer: this env file backs the flaky integration
# tests for the Coppervale payments service. About one run in five, the
# sandbox ledger times out and the suite retries with cached fixtures,
# which is why you'll see duplicate charge assertions in the logs — it's
# noisy but harmless. We're tracking a proper fix for next sprint. The
# tests can't even reach the sandbox without auth, though, so the
# sandbox credential gets appended on the line right below this comment.

vault entry, yahif-yajep: COURIER_KEY29=b802bdf8034096b65a51c6ba5abe2

Handover — Oriflame config hot-reload. Watcher on the Penner cluster reloads config on SIGHUP; file-watch path is disabled, don't re-enable it. If reload wedges, the loader holds a stale lock in /var/run/oriflame. Kill the loader, not the main proc. Rollback config lives in the snapshots bucket, last known good tagged thursday. Escalations: none open. To unseal the config signing key if a full restart is needed, use the passphrase below.

vault phrase of bagaf-kajeg = jorath-feniel-briir-siliel-ralix

Visitors may not use the Harwick Yard bike cage or drive through the staff parking gates; both are reserved for employees of Tellbrook Systems. Guests should use the public stands on Creel Lane and be escorted from reception. Staff opening the gates for deliveries must log the entry first. The gate code follows below.

door code, yagap-bahof: bdg-O-05

### Step 4: Pick your compression posture

Heads up: Burrowlink 3.x enables per-message websocket deflate by default. That's great for chatty dashboards, but it chews CPU on the relay nodes and can actually hurt latency for small binary frames. We saw about 12% CPU uplift in the Fernvale cluster, so we dialed the window size down rather than disabling it outright. The settings we shipped to production are as follows.

config for kafof-bawef:
holath:
  log_level: debug
  metrics_host: metrics.holath.qorvelsys.internal
  pin: 2191
  pool_size: 32